But none of the above is Bosch's strongest skill. Bosch's top technology is zeolite drying, which is Bosch's patented technology. Let me focus on the characteristics of this technology.
Zeolite technology is a technology with five functions of washing, drying, cleaning, storage and protection, and it is also the main selling point of Bosch's high-end products. ...
The core of this technology is zeolite.
Image source: Baidu Encyclopedia, Zeolite
Now in science, zeolite can even absorb radiation and is widely used in rocket fuel and spacecraft.
Because zeolite has the characteristics of moisture absorption and heat release, Bosch uses it to make this drying system. ..
We know the principle of this thing, so let's take a look at the actual working steps.
Step 1: The fan sucks the wet air in the dishwasher into the pipeline, and the wet air enters the zeolite bin after being roughly filtered by the stainless steel deflector on the inner wall.
Step 2: When zeolite meets wet air, it will release a lot of heat. Note that the heat release here does not require any electricity. The heater blows hot air in different directions in the dishwasher to dry the dishes.
In this process, the fan runs intermittently, knowing that the water vapor in the adsorption bin is clean, and the inner wall temperature can reach 80℃ when releasing heat, so there is no need to worry about the sterilization effect. Even after 96 hours, the sterilization effect can reach 99%. It is very convenient to store tableware with zeolite, which meets the storage requirements of household dishwashers.
